The vulnerability of the Print Server sub-component of the Oracle One-to-One Fulfillment system, a business automation solution from Oracle E-Business Suite, allows a malicious actor to gain access to modify, add, or delete data.

Print Server in Oracle Fulfillment has access control flaws enabling remote data modify, add, or delete via hypertext transfer protocol.
